Osim udvostručenog pročelja s gotičkom triforom i bočnim biforama, to se posebice odnosi na element ugaone lođe, poput lođa kakve se u simetričnom paru pojavljuju na pročeljima dvaju dubrovačkih ljetnikovaca kasnog 16. stoljeća (Sorgo-Natali i Mleci), dok je znatno ranija lođa ljetnikovca Kaboga-Zec oblikovno i funkcionalno donekle usporediva s bočnim “prohodnim” lođama ranoga 16. stoljeća. Srodnosti s objema vrstama lođa ukazuju na prijelazni oblik, odnosno na moguće najraniji primjer ugaone lođe u korpusu dubrovačke ladanjske arhitekture, a time i na lokalno podrijetlo ovoga arhitektonskog motiva.

The role of personal iconography has been recognised mainly in his secular fresco commissions. This paper focuses on the analysis of the ceiling painting and furnishings of the pilgrimage church of the Holy Virgin at Zagorje near Pilštanj in Styria (Slovenia) and decodes the interweaving of Virgin (Madonna with Grapes, Assumpta, Regina Coeli, the Immaculate Conception), Holy Family, Holy Kinship and other saints worship with representations of the Attems family. In 1708 and 1709, the church was frescoed by Matthias von Görz, and in the following years, it obtained the main Virgin’ s altar and the altars of St Joseph and St Dismas in the lateral chapels. The Baroque decoration followed a unified iconographic concept in which the family memoria systematically builds on and complements the theological programme. Attems presented himself in the imitatio of the Holy Family, following the example of the Habsburg family.

The dissenting nature of those relations, which were based on the mutual wish to limit the Soviet hegemony within the global communist movement, is in the focus of this analysis. Finally, this paper aims to demonstrate how the roots of the close friendship between the two parties during the sixties and seventies can be traced back to 1956, and how the Yugoslav communists influenced or tried to influence their Italian counterparts.

Specifically, it analyses the initial system of accountability implemented by the first Italian higher school of commerce in the nineteenth century, with a particular focus on the use of cash and accrual methods. The microhistorical analysis draws on accountability and stakeholder theories and uses both primary and secondary information sources to investigate the original, hybrid approach adopted by the school, focusing on its dual accountability system. The results section explains the involvement of the government in establishing and recognising the school as a strategic asset for the entire kingdom, contradicting criticisms present in the extant literature; we also examine the innovative accountability process implemented by the school to satisfy the reporting needs of its salient stakeholders. The school was able to apply its accountability competences to implement a dual system, preserving its priorities as based on the relationships between its stakeholders’ needs (the old accountability system), educational skills (teaching the new accountability system) and the wider (national) implications resulting in an improvement of the entire accountability system.

Hofmeester; René van der Wal;Digital surveillance technologies enable a range of publics to observe the private lives of wild animals. Publics can now encounter wildlife from their smartphones, home computers, and other digital devices. These technologies generate public-wildlife relations that produce digital intimacy, but also summon wildlife into relations of care, commodification, and control. Via three case studies, this paper examines the biopolitical implications of such technologically mediated human-animal relations, which are becoming increasingly common and complex in the Digital Anthropocene. Each of our case studies involves a different biopolitical rationale deployed by a scientific-managerial regime: (1) clampdown (wild boar); (2) care (golden eagle); and (3) control (moose). Each of these modalities of biopower, however, is entangled with the other, inaugurating complex relations between publics, scientists, and wildlife. We show how digital technologies can predetermine certain representations of wildlife by encouraging particular gazes, which can have negative repercussions for public-wildlife relations in both digital and offline spaces. However, there remains work to be done to understand the positive public-wildlife relations inaugurated by digital mediation. Here, departing from much extant literature on digital human-animal relations, we highlight some of these positive potentials, notably: voice, immediacy, and agency.

(1631-1667), un príncipe musulmán marroquí convertido al cristianismo que luego entró en la Compañía de Jesús. El objetivo del artículo será demostrar cómo este miʿrāǧ latino se basó en una fuente árabe relacionada con la literatura de ḥadīṯ. Como método para alcanzar nuestro objetivo, haremos un estudio comparativo de las fuentes de las que Baldassare pudo tener conocimiento. Además, mostraremos el modo en que Baldassarre intentó no solo polemizar con la tradición islámica, sino también las estrategias que utilizó para cristianizarla.

This article locates the roots of Mexico’s current drug-related violence in a longer history of state terror and violence enacted against social movements and rural communities. The article traces this history by grounding it locally in the guerrerense municipality of Coyuca de Catalán. Resumen: El norte chiquito: De “guerras sucias” a guerras de drogas en Tierra Caliente de GuerreroLa mal llamada “guerra contra las drogas” en México empezó como una guerra contra los pobres. Este articulo ubica las raíces de la violencia en el México contemporáneo dentro una historia de terrorismo de estado y violencia durante la década de los años 70. Para desenredar estas raíces, el artículo ofrece una perspectiva histórica y local basada en el municipio guerrerense de Coyuca de Catalán.

Alongside the interests of some producers wishing to highlight the geographical origin of their products, there are conflicting interests of other producers who, for different reasons, prefer not to disclose the origin of their product. Then there are also interests of consumers interested at receiving an ever greater and transparency of the extensive information on the product offered. The indication of the origin of a food product can also constitute an element that has an impact on the proper functioning of the internal market to the extent that it can ultimately induce consumers to purchase national products or, at least, it may affect their purchasing choices: it is therefore necessary to assess the compatibility of the mandatory indication of the origin of the food with the principle of the free movement of goods. This competition of interests explains why the European Union’s legislation on this point is somewhat ambiguous: this paper, apart from the presentation of collective marks and certification marks which, although in a limited way, may contain references to the geographical origin of the products, points out to the provisions contained in Regulation EU 1169/2011 on the provision of food information to consumers, as well as the provisions regulating the products with PDO and PGI certificates.
